China’s Ministry of Industry and Information Technology (MIT) announced that China’s total shipbuilding production between January and March this year was 9.17 million deadweight tons (dwt), down 4.6% year-on-year.During the period, China’s new ship orders were 15.18 million dwt, up 53.0% year-on-year. As of the end of March this year, the book orders of China’s shipbuilding industry enterprises were 114.52 million deadweight tons, an increase of 15.6% year-on-year.
In the first three months, China’s shipbuilding output and newbuilding orders accounted for 43.5% and 62.9% of the total global market, respectively. At the end of the first three months, Chinese shipbuilders accounted for 50.8% of the total global ship orders on their books.
